Trial Begins For Former MSU Professor Charged With Murder

(KTTS News) — A former Missouri State University professor is in on trial this week for stabbing a fellow professor to death.

Edward Gutting is charged with breaking into retired professor Marc Cooper’s Springfield home in 2016.

Court records say Gutting stabbed Cooper to death and attacked his wife, Nancy, when she tried to stop him.

Police say Gutting was drunk at the time.

Prosecutors say Gutting held a grudge against Cooper because he wasn’t hired to replace him when he retired.

Cooper’s wife took the stand Monday and told the court that Gutting threatened to kill her if she got in his way.

Gutting was deemed unfit for trial in 2019, but in 2020 his case was cleared to proceed.
